    Manage between 35-40 patent translation projects ranging in size of 1,000-100,000 words from start to finish for languages in Europe, Asia and Latin America, serving as a single point of contact for their successful completion. Establish and maintain professional relationships with our vendors to ensure consistent business needs are metUnderstand the different patent filing requirements under the Patent Cooperation Treaty (PCT), Paris Convention (Direct-Paris) and the European Patent Office (EP Validation). Recreate and format MS Word files to ensure filing requirements meet country specific requirementsCommunicate with client facing accounts and provide a quality service when addressing translation questions, requesting extensions or delivering projects. Coordinate with linguists and ensure instructions are clear and promote time management to meet deadlinesCoordinate with Account Executives (AE) to maximize budgets and strategically utilize patent extensions to ensure a quality translation is producedAnalyze translation memory software statistics to set budgets and deadlines while understanding language trends and client specific glossaries to maximize consistency and quality Establish and negotiate rates and deadlines with patent experienced linguists and agents in order to maximize profitability, efficiency and the accuracy of a translation. Review translated files for a quality check and connect with linguist/ address any questions or concerns when needed. Provide feedback for improvement based on client and filing agent notes Address project concerns to AE and liaise work to project assistants or external resources to meet ongoing project demands. Investigate and resolve client concerns and problem solve while documenting all the relevant information to prevent issues from reoccuring
